基于SSM框架的OKR绩效考核系统设计与实现

需积分: 0 3 下载量 45 浏览量 更新于2024-10-11 收藏 5.51MB ZIP 举报
资源摘要信息:"ssm企业绩效填报系统100910(附源码+数据库)" ssm企业绩效填报系统是一个采用Java语言开发,利用Spring、SpringMVC和MyBatis(ssm框架)搭建的Web应用程序,它遵循OKR(Objectives and Key Results)绩效考核制度,实现了企业内部绩效填报、审核、汇总和统计等功能。该系统主要由三个模块组成:公司高管模块、部门主管模块和普通员工模块。此外,系统中还嵌入了Vue.js前端框架和Redis缓存技术,并使用MySQL作为后端数据库。 公司高管模块: 1. 个人中心:展示高管的个人工号、入职时间、公司季度OKR和公司年度OKR等基本信息。 2. 用户管理:包含对系统内用户的创建、删除、权限分配等管理操作。 3. 绩效查阅:允许高管查看员工的绩效数据。 4. 绩效审批:高管需对员工的绩效进行审核和批准。 部门主管模块: 1. 个人中心:展示主管的个人工号、入职时间、部门季度OKR和部门年度OKR等基本信息。 2. 绩效申报:部门主管负责填写部门绩效申报,包括自评等级和评语。 3. 绩效审批:主管负责审批部门普通员工提交的绩效申报。 4. 绩效查阅:主管可以查阅部门绩效数据。 普通员工模块: 1. 个人中心:展示员工的个人工号、入职时间、个人季度OKR和个人年度OKR等基本信息。 2. 绩效申报:员工在此模块中进行个人绩效申报,填写自评等级和评语。 3. 绩效查阅:员工可以查阅自己的绩效数据。 系统使用Vue.js前端框架,提供了丰富的交互式UI组件和响应式数据绑定,使系统的用户界面更加友好。同时,系统采用Redis缓存数据,加速了数据库的读写速度,提高了系统的响应时间和性能。 系统后端使用MySQL数据库,负责存储用户信息、OKR绩效目标、绩效申报数据以及审批记录等。数据库的设计必须遵循良好的规范化原则,以确保数据的完整性和一致性。 本系统附带完整的源代码和数据库,为开发人员提供了学习和参考的机会,同时也方便企业直接部署使用。此外,本系统具备良好的扩展性和维护性,便于企业根据自身需求进行定制和升级。 从技术栈的角度来看,本系统采用了业界广泛使用的技术组合,确保了系统的稳定性和可靠性。ssm框架作为Java后端开发的主流技术之一,通过Spring进行依赖注入和事务管理,SpringMVC处理请求映射和视图解析,MyBatis进行数据库操作,共同构建了一个高效、稳定的系统架构。Vue.js和Redis的集成则进一步提升了系统的性能和用户体验。 以上便是关于"ssm企业绩效填报系统100910(附源码+数据库)"的核心知识点和功能介绍。该系统是现代企业绩效管理的有效工具,帮助企业在互联网环境下实现绩效管理的自动化和信息化。